Laser marking technology is increasingly being used in a wide range of industries. Currently, Laser Cutting Machine are being used in a wide range of industries, including electronic cigarettes, hardware, pharmaceutical packaging, alcohol packaging, architectural ceramics, beverage packaging, rubber products, nameplates, craft gifts, electronic components, leather, integrated circuits, electrical appliances, mobile communications, tool accessories, precision instruments, eyewear and watches, jewelry, automotive parts, plastic buttons, building materials, PVC pipes, and many other areas. Laser marking technology can be used to mark graphics and text.
